For what it's worth, a lesson I learnt was to ask them to fire up the
actual laptop they're going to give you before you buy it. I ended up
with a live pixel, and apparently you need to have at least three before
they'll replace it. It's only a minor annoyance, but I would have
refused it if I'd had the sense to test it before I took it home.
